It is time to replace my brake fluid on my 2001 X. I did a search on the forum and didn't find anyone posting about this. I was wondering if anyone had any info or experiences they would like to share if and when you replaced your brake fluid with one of these products .
I'm thinking about going with either the ATE Super Blue or a synthetic brake fluid. Haven't decided which synthetic and am leaning more towards the ATE Super Blue based on
http://www.swedishbricks.net/700900FAQ/Brake%20Fluid%20Comparison.htm, which stated:
..."conclusion: ATE Type 200 and Super Blue are not only the cheapest of the performance brake fluids, they are also the cheapest per degree of boil protection, and have a very high 6-month BP estimate...."
Has anyone used ATE Super Blue in their X?
